Why Used Cars Lose Their Appeal Over Time

Vehicles naturally age. As years pass, maintenance needs often increase. Some owners begin facing repeated repair bills, while others find that spare parts are becoming harder to source.

Several factors can make people consider selling their vehicles:

  • Engine problems
  • Transmission issues
  • Rust and body damage
  • High fuel consumption
  • Costly repairs
  • Long periods without use

Things That Affect a Used Vehicle’s Worth

No two vehicles are exactly the same. Several factors influence how much interest a used vehicle receives.

Vehicle Age

Older vehicles generally have more wear and may require repairs.

Condition

A car with major mechanical faults will usually attract different buyers than one in running condition.

Make and Model

Some brands have strong demand due to their parts and popularity.

Service History

Maintenance records can provide useful information about how the vehicle has been looked after.

Demand for Parts

Certain vehicles remain attractive because their components can still be reused.

Preparing a Used Vehicle Before Selling

Spending a little time preparing your car can make the process easier.

Remove Personal Items

Check the glove box, boot, and storage areas for belongings.

Gather Documents

Having registration papers and service records available can help answer questions about the vehicle.

Take Photographs

Clear photos provide a good overview of the car’s condition.

Make Notes

Write down information such as:

  • Vehicle year
  • Make and model
  • Odometer reading
  • Mechanical issues
  • Accident history

These details help create a clear picture of the vehicle.

Environmental Reasons for Selling Old Vehicles

Unused vehicles often occupy valuable space and may deteriorate over time. Fluids can leak, tyres can perish, and metal parts can corrode.

Many components from old vehicles can still serve a purpose. Parts such as engines, doors, wheels, batteries, and metal materials may be reused or recycled.

This process helps reduce waste and encourages more responsible management of vehicle materials.
